Possible Side Effects & Counseling Points
Common:
- Temporary numbness, mild irritation at site
- Skin or mucosal redness
Serious/Rare:
- Methemoglobinemia (rare risk with benzocaine, especially in infants and high-dose applications)—monitor for pale/blue skin, difficulty breathing
- Allergic reaction (skin rash, swelling, difficulty breathing)
- Excessive application may increase systemic risk—always follow compounder/prescriber guidelines
Safety: Counsel patients not to use on large areas or broken skin unless directed. For pediatric products, use only as prescribed and avoid frequent/repeated application.
Precautions
- Professional prescription compounding only
- Must not be used in children under 2 years except under strict provider supervision
- Avoid use in patients with benzocaine or PABA allergies
- Monitor for signs of methemoglobinemia, especially in infants, elderly, or those with respiratory disorders
